09:05 EDTAZNAstraZeneca suspends buyback program, confirms 2012 outlook
AstraZeneca announced that it is suspending share repurchases with immediate effect. During 2012 the company has completed net share repurchases of $2.3B in respect of its initial target of $4.5B. AstraZeneca confirms its EPS target range for 2012 is maintained at $6.00 to $6.30. Pascal Soriot, Chief Executive Officer, AstraZeneca said: "As I assume my new responsibilities at AstraZeneca, I believe this is a prudent step that maintains flexibility while the Board and I complete the company's ongoing annual strategy update."

16:07 EDTAZNActavis confirms appeal court issues injunction related to Resupules
Actavis (ACT) confirmed that the United States Court of Appeals for the Federal Circuit has granted a motion by AstraZeneca (AZN) to enjoin Actavis from further distribution of its generic version of AstraZeneca's Pulmicort Respules 0.25, 0.5 mg products, pending resolution of AstraZeneca's appeal before the court.

09:29 EDTAZNAstraZeneca says Phase III studies of Naloxegol met primary, secondary endpoints
AstraZeneca (AZN) presented the results of two pivotal Phase III studies of naloxegol showing the 25 mg dose of the investigational drug met its primary and secondary endpoints for efficacy and showed a safety profile consistent with previous studies. Data was presented at the Digestive Disease Week meeting in Orlando, Florida. The primary endpoint in both trials was percentage of OIC responders, versus placebo, over 12 weeks of treatment. The secondary endpoints included the 12-week response rate in a laxative inadequate response population, the median time to first spontaneous bowel movement and the number of days per-week with at least one bowel movement. Plans for naloxegol will be finalized over the coming months, incorporating the outcome of ongoing discussions with health authorities in the US, EU and Canada, the company said. Naloxegol, a peripherally-acting mu-opioid receptor antagonist, has been specifically designed for the treatment of opioid-induced constipation and is part of the exclusive worldwide license agreement announced on 21 September 2009, between AstraZeneca and Nektar Therapeutics (NKTR).

08:41 EDTAZNImpax commenced shipment of authorized generic Zomig
Impax (IPXL) announced that its generics division, Global Pharmaceuticals, commenced shipment of authorized generic Zomig tablets, as part of an agreement with AstraZeneca (AZN). Zomig is indicated for the treatment of migraine headaches in adults. According to IMS Health data, U.S. sales of Zomig tablets and orally disintegrating tablets were approximately $196M in the 12 months ended April 2013.

16:53 EDTAZNOptimer gets bids from AstraZeneca, Cubist, Astellas, Bloomberg says
Optimer (OPTR) has received first round bids from AstraZeneca (AZN), Cubist (CBST), and Astellas, reports Bloomberg, citing people familiar with the matter. Shares of Optimer spiked higher following the report, closing up $1.85, or 14.44%, to $14.66. The report notes the company disclosed almost three months ago it was exploring its strategic options.
